Output 150b7e86c528ae378de09b155259c815e23316469a9c8dad68f0c887ba6231f9:1

value
591712700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02aa9b311983c15b809429d8f44c9a5a3f45549f OP_EQUAL
address
M89FxjyHPLiURN5dCw2eoncBF7t69XHfoG
transaction
150b7e86c528ae378de09b155259c815e23316469a9c8dad68f0c887ba6231f9
spent
true